Merthyr fight back for top spot

Premiership round-up

MERTHYR battled back from 12-3 down at half time to run out eventual 17-12 victors at Beddau and return to the top of the Welsh Premiership.
Wing Ewan Roberts and full-back Cody Baker, one converted by Ollie Wilde, had threatened to send Merthyr to only their second defeat of the campaign.
However, second-half tries from hooker Ellis Shipp and outside-half Ben Jones edged it for the Ironmen at Mount Pleasant Park.
Jones kicked both conversions having landed a first half penalty.
